OTRFU on membership drive

The Old Thomian Rugby Football Union (OTRFU) has launched a renewed membership drive to enrol former rugby players who have represented the college at any age group to join its ranks.

In addition, the OTRFU will be granting affiliated membership to those persons who have assisted and who are assisting Thomian rugby.

The 1st affiliate membership was granted to Quentin Israel a former 1st XV rugby coach. All Old Thomians who have played rugby are requested to apply for membership immediately.

All persons applying for membership and existing members and any persons who wish to coach the college at any level in 2004 or who wish to assist financially or otherwise are requested to inform the Secretary OTRFU No. 15, Bellantara Road, Dehiwala, in writing immediately. The OTRFU is expected to play a major role in Thomian rugby development for 2004 onwards and expects all Old Thomian rugby players and supporters to positively respond to the call.
